New Software "CFE-Test" for Energy Efficiency Evaluation of Cooker Hoods According to IEC 61591:2023

The ILK (Institute for Air and Refrigeration Technology) is developing new software for the energy efficiency evaluation of Cooking Fume Extractors, which will be available from the second quarter of 2025. The "CFE-Test" software (Cooking Fume Extractors, CFE) meets the requirements of IEC 61591:2023 as well as the corresponding EU directive.

Key Features of the New Software

The "CFE-Test" software offers numerous features to optimize and accelerate testing processes. The key features include:

  • Recording of all relevant measurement values
  • Automatic selection of the most appropriate pressure sensor
  • Control of auxiliary fan and throttle device
  • Online display of measurement curves during the test process
  • Export of measurement and calculation values in a file, e.g., for Excel
  • Automatic calculation of characteristic values and conversion of measurement data to reference conditions

Main Changes in IEC 61591:2023

One of the most significant changes is the introduction of the 9-point method for creating the energy efficiency label. This method forms the basis for evaluating the energy efficiency of cooker hoods, as illustrated in the following graphic.

Additionally, a new energy efficiency label has been introduced, which displays information such as annual energy consumption and noise levels of the hood.
